Authoring Life operates as a 501(c)3 nonprofit under the umbrella of the Women's Nonprofit Alliance. Authoring Life works to eradicate illiteracy through early intervention so that every child has the opportunity to write the story they want to read.

 

Through books, literacy resources, scholarships, and educational opportunities, Authoring Life is on a mission to ensure that every child, regardless of zip code, has the opportunity to acquire literacy skills and books to become who they were created to be. 

Authoring Life currently aids children from 17 different countries, and 13 U.S. States.

OUR STORY:

As a published author, our founder, Madi Franquiz, makes regular appearances in schools and libraries all across the country for career days or to host her writers conference. At one particular event in a North Dallas community, she was spending the afternoon with an entire elementary school. Upon the entry of the 3rd grade class, she was approached by one of the teachers. She asked “could you dumb your presentation down for this class?” “Of course” she said, but she was curious. She needed to know more! She told the teacher that she had been strategic in her creation of these programs and made certain that they were age appropriate, at a level that each grade could understand. She lowered her voice and said “Madi, these kids are reading at or below the kindergarten level.” That’s when Madi realized we have a literacy problem that has been exacerbated by the global pandemic, and something had to be done. Madi began looking for opportunities to make a difference for children in literacy.

As a result of her early childhood experience of living in poverty and her adult experiences serving in Title 1 schools, Madi is a passionate children's literacy advocate, recognized around the world for her philanthropic work. Today, alongside our international partners, Authoring Life is on a mission to ensure that every child, regardless of zip code, has the opportunity to acquire literacy skills and books to become who they were created to be.

Accessing books early on is crucial for a child to reach key literacy milestones. Without developing these foundations, their education, confidence, and joy in reading is not likely to be realized. Having books at home is essential to beginning a child's journey to a quality education and better future opportunities.

We at Authoring Life are committed to bridging the literacy gap for those children who live in poverty- that is why we are so excited to announce our new partnership with Half Priced Books of Richardson with a goal of placing 100,000 books into impoverished communities across Texas over the next year.

Authoring Life is working to ensure that children all across Texas have the opportunity to read more.
